agents is a portable agent definition, built to any provider.
Define an agent once — identity, instructions, connectors, and schedules — then render it into provider-specific artifacts. Conventional subdirectories are discovered automatically.
agents/<my-agent>/
agent.yaml identity, model tier, permissions, providers — and, for
a coordinator, its roster's name/version pins
instructions.md the system prompt
questions.yaml optional: pre-registered questions, read at runtime
connectors/ optional: one MCP server per file
schedules/ optional: one recurring run per file
skills/ optional: one directory per skill, mounted by name
subagents/<name>/ optional, one level only: a full agent directory per
subagent — same shape as above, minus schedules/ and
subagents/ of its own
dist/ built output (committed so every deploy is a diff)
An agent with a multiagent block in agent.yaml is a coordinator: it names a version-pinned roster, and every entry needs a matching directory under subagents/ (checked in both directions — an undeclared subagent or a subagent with no matching entry both fail the build). A subagent has no clock of its own, so it declares no schedules/; delegation stops at one level, so it declares no subagents/ either. pnpm deploy --provider claude --dry-run--dry-run renders and reports without publishing. Deploy refuses stale dist/. Every schedule's prompt is required — it becomes the deploy API's initial_events user message, since a scheduled run has no one at a keyboard to open it.

model is a tier (strong, …), not a vendor id — each provider resolves it and records what shipped. Secrets stay literal in dist/ (e.g. ${ANALYTICS_MCP_URL}) and resolve at deploy time.
Not every provider expresses every feature — cursor has no coordinator concept, so a coordinator's providers: block should simply omit a cursor: key, and the build skips that combination cleanly rather than rendering something cursor cannot express. Declaring a provider that genuinely can't support what an agent needs (a multiagent roster, a stdio connector, per-connector ask, skills) still fails the build loudly — never a silent, degraded artifact.
